Object History

Object History

History วัตถุมี URL ที่ผู้ใช้เข้าเว็บไซต์ไปแล้ว

History วัตถุเป็นส่วนหนึ่งของวัตถุ window และสามารถเข้าถึงได้ผ่านทาง window.history

หมายเหตุ:ไม่มีมาตรฐานที่เปิดเผยสำหรับ History วัตถุ แต่ทุกเบราซเซอร์ทุกตัวรองรับวัตถุนี้

ทางเลือกของ History วัตถุ

ทางเลือก อธิบาย
length กลับค่าจำนวน URL ในรายการประวัติการทำงานของเบราซเซอร์

วิธีของ History วัตถุ

วิธี อธิบาย
back() โหลด URL ก่อนหน้าของรายการ history
forward() โหลด URL ต่อไปของรายการ history
go() โหลดหน้าเว็บที่เฉพาะของรายการ history

History วัตถุอธิบาย

History วัตถุเดิมถูกออกแบบมาเพื่อแสดงประวัติการทำงานของหน้าต่าง แต่ด้วยเหตุผลทางความเป็นส่วนตัว วัตถุ History ไม่อนุญาตให้สคริปต์เข้าถึง URL ที่เคยเข้าเว็บไซต์ไปแล้ว ฟังก์ชันที่ยังคงใช้ได้เท่านั้นคือ back()forward() และ go() วิธี

ตัวอย่าง

การทำงานของรหัสบรรทัดด้านล่างนี้เหมือนกับการกดปุ่มถอยหลัง

history.back()

การทำงานของรหัสบรรทัดด้านล่างนี้เหมือนกับการกดปุ่มถอยหลังสองครั้ง

history.go(-2)